Zγ ∗ production in e + e − interactions at √ s = 183 − 209 GeV The DELPHI Collaboration

Measurements of Zγ production are presented using data collected by the DELPHI detector at centre-of-mass energies ranging from 183 to 209 GeV, corresponding to an integrated luminosity of about 667 pb. The measurements cover a wide range of the possible final state four-fermion configurations: hadronic and leptonic (eeqq̄, μμqq̄, qq̄νν̄), fully leptonic (lll ′+l ′−) and fully hadronic final states (qq̄qq̄, with a low mass qq̄ pair). Measurements of the Zγ cross-section for the various final states have been compared with the Standard Model expectations and found to be consistent within the errors. In addition, a total cross-section measurement of the lll ′+l − cross-section is reported, and found to be in agreement with the prediction of the Standard Model.
